Address

NMmKGvgX6nWGpUgMSQYkj6p9MCkHSguK5A

0 XNA

Confirmed
Total Received98.44527436 XNA
Total Sent98.44527436 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NMmKGvgX6nWGpUgMSQYkj6p9MCkHSguK5A98.44527436 XNA
 
 
NMmKGvgX6nWGpUgMSQYkj6p9MCkHSguK5A98.44527436 XNA